Has there ever been a 4 0 NBA final?
In 1975, after compiling a 48–34 regular season record, the Golden State Warriors swept the Washington Bullets 4–0 in the 1975 NBA Finals.
Do they play all 7 games in NBA Finals?
There have been 13 NBA postseasons without a Game 7, but it's been a while since that last happened. The most recent playoffs without any Game 7s was 1999, back when the first round had best-of-five series. Every playoffs in the 21st century has featured at least one Game 7.
40 related questions foundWho won more NBA titles?
Boston Celtics center Bill Russell holds the record for the most NBA championships won with 11 titles during his 13-year playing career. He won his first championship with the Boston Celtics in his rookie year.

What NBA team has no championships?
How many teams have not won an NBA Championship? There are 11 active NBA teams that have not won a Championship, this equates to 36% of League. The teams that have not won a NBA Championship are; the Pacers, Hornets, Nets, Grizzlies, Jazz, Suns, Pelicans, Clippers, Nuggets Magic and the Timberwolves.

What is a 3 peat in basketball?
The defintion of a three-peat is a contraction of the words three and repeat and means winning a championship three times in a row. An example of a three-peat is when the Los Angeles Lakers basketball team won the NBA finals from 2000-2002.
How many 3 peats did Michael Jordan have?
They are known for having one of the NBA's greatest dynasties, winning six NBA championships between 1991 and 1998 with two three-peats. All six of their championship teams were led by Hall of Famers Michael Jordan, Scottie Pippen, and coach Phil Jackson.

Did the Celtics won 8 championships in a row?
Championships | Boston Celtics. Seventeen NBA Championships. A record eight in a row from 1959-1966.
Has anyone won 3 NBA championships with 3 different teams?
The first player in NBA history to win a title with three different franchises is John Salley (USA) while playing for the Detroit Pistons (USA, 1989-90), Chicago Bulls (USA, 1996) and Los Angeles Lakers (USA, 2000).
